Add 30/81 and 42/27
1st number: 30/81, 2nd number: 1 15/27
30/81 + 42/27 is 52/27.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 81 and 27 is 81
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 81 - For the 1st fraction, since 81 × 1 = 81,
30/81 = 30 × 1/81 × 1 = 30/81 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 27 × 3 = 81,
42/27 = 42 × 3/27 × 3 = 126/81 - Add the two like fractions:
30/81 + 126/81 = 30 + 126/81 = 156/81 - 156/81 simplified gives 52/27
- So, 30/81 + 42/27 = 52/27
